在****项目中,网站需要显示各城市天气,提高用户体验。
项目组经过考虑,选择了通过第三方webservice服务来调用其他网站的天气服务。基于此我们查看服务说明,了解支持的服务接口。
在开发和测试阶段,我们.借助wsimport命令工具自动生成客户端代码。
WebService流程为,首先通过三级联动获得城市对应的ID,并导入所需要的依赖包。
当用户查询城市的请求信息到达系统时,系统将对应城市的信息通过第三方接口发送到webService,并的到处理结果
将处理结果通过ajax和fastjson将webService返回的json对象解析到前台并展示